## Further reading

Zero-downtime schema migrations on the Carvelle platform follow the expand–migrate–contract pattern: add new columns first, backfill with the Driftplow tool, switch reads, then drop old columns in a later release. Never combine expand and contract in one deploy, and always verify backfill completion before flipping the read path. The full migration playbook, including rollback checklists and timing guidance, is maintained on our internal page here.

wiki page, tahaf-tajog: https://jira.ordindyn.corp/pipeline

Subject: Cut-over summary — Quickfind autocomplete

Migrated the Quickfind autocomplete index from the old Harborn cluster Tuesday night. p95 latency dropped from 820ms to 95ms. One hiccup: prefix queries under three characters were briefly unserved; fixed by backfilling the shortgram shards. Old cluster stays read-only for two weeks. New index runs with the following configuration.

settings of tajep-tafog:
CASDOR_LOG_LEVEL=info
CASDOR_METRICS_HOST=metrics.casdor.nelvrosys.internal
CASDOR_POOL_SIZE=16

Leadership Review Briefing – Next Year's Headcount, Pindrow Labs

Quick summary for the finance folks ahead of Thursday's review. We're planning a modest net increase of twelve roles, weighted toward the Greymont engineering team, offset by natural attrition in support functions. Contractor spend should drop once the two conversion hires land. Nothing dramatic, but the phasing matters for cash flow, so flag concerns early. The confidential note on business plans sits just below.

board note of kagep-yahig: Only 9 of the 120 pilot accounts renewed Quenix, so a churn review is set for April 1.

## Schema Registry Approvals

All event schemas published to the Lanternwood Registry must pass review before deployment. This protects downstream consumers at Brindlecore from breaking changes. New fields may be added freely, but removing or retyping a field requires a formal approval ticket and a two-week deprecation notice. Compatibility checks run automatically in CI, but they are advisory only — human sign-off is mandatory. Schema approval authority for the events platform currently rests with one designated owner, named below.

account owner for bawip-tahag: Raleth Quenok